Regulation by region

The entity you sign with โ€” and your protection โ€” changes depending on where you live.

United Kingdom
FCA + FSCSECN/STP
FXOpen Ltd (FRN 579202) โ€” FSCS up to ยฃ85,000. The most solid arm. Verify the official domain (there are clones)
European Union
โš  CySEC but owner indictedECN/STP
FXOpen EU Ltd (194/13) โ€” ICF up to โ‚ฌ20,000. Red flag: Jul 2024 CySEC suspended the rights of shareholder A. Klimenka, charged in the US with money laundering tied to BTC-e
United States
Doesn't provide services
No NFA/CFTC registration
Australia
โš  ASIC license CANCELLED
ASIC cancelled AFSL 412871 (Sep-2024) for serious deficiencies. Not authorized in Australia
Rest of the world
Offshore Nevis (no scheme)ECN/STP
FXOpen Markets Limited (Nevis, C 42235) โ€” no strong regulator and no compensation. Holding of the owner charged with BTC-e money laundering

Breakdown by axis

The total score (out of 100) is the sum of the 7 axes, with the same yardstick for everyone. Below each one, the rationale with its source.

Regulation: Offshore6/22 pts
Why: FCA 579202 (UK) + CySEC, BUT ASIC 412871 CANCELLED (Sep 2024); the bulk of worldwide retail via FXOpen Markets (Nevis, unregulated, only Financial Commission)
Withdrawals / payments: Isolated complaints10/20 pts
Why: no documented systemic denial pattern (withdrawal data couldn't be verified); the serious problem is integrity, not withdrawals
Fund safety: Segregated (no compensation)8/15 pts
Why: segregated UK/EU (Barclays/Lloyds) + FSCS GBP85k; the Nevis entity with no statutory segregation or compensation
Transparency: Misleading0/10 pts
Why: SERIOUS: owner Aliaksandr Klimenka charged by the US DOJ with money laundering (BTC-e case, Feb 2024); CySEC suspended his voting rights; CFTC fine 2011
Reputation: Damaged0/10 pts
Why: founded 2005; owner charged with money laundering + ASIC license canceled; Trustpilot ~3.8 (~430 reviews)
Costs: Competitive8/8 pts
Why: ECN Raw 0.0 pip + $1.5-3.5/side; min $100
